A federal court granted an amparo this Wednesday, September 7, to the former director of Petróleos Mexicanos, Emilio Lozoya, which annuls the justified preventive detention against him.
Jenaro Villamil, president of the Public Broadcasting System of the Mexican State (SPR), said on his social networks that a judge will have “the last word on his release.”
On June 6, the Attorney General’s Office reported that Lozoya would remain in prison because there had been no fulfilled the mandatory damage repair in the Odebrecht and Agronitrogenados cases for which he is accused.
According to the newspaper Reform, On April 11, Pemex accepted a $10 million reparation agreement from Emilio Lozoya. so that the two cases for which he is accused are provisionally suspended.
Also, in the same month of April, Lozoya filed an accusation against him for the crime of tax fraudThis after it was said that the former director of Pemex did not pay 2.6 million pesos corresponding to the 2016 fiscal year.
Lozoya, who has been extradited to Mexico for two years, promised to pay the 2.6 million pesos to the Ministry of Finance and Public Credit as repair of the damage, which has been managed in accordance with the FGR report this Monday.
